** The kitchen remodeling market for a rural community like Bazine is characterized by a reliance on regional contractors from larger hub cities like Hays and Great Bend. There is minimal competition *within* Bazine itself, so homeowners typically engage contractors from these service areas. The quality of work is generally high, as these established companies rely on reputation and word-of-mouth in tight-knit rural communities. Competition among regional providers is moderate, driving a focus on customer service. Typical pricing is in line with national averages for mid-range remodels, but project costs can be influenced by travel distance and material transport logistics to a rural location. Homeowners should expect to pay a premium for highly customized, luxury materials and complex structural changes. It is standard practice for contractors in this region to charge a service area fee for locations outside their immediate city.

For a full remodel in Bazine, including new cabinets, countertops, flooring, and appliances, homeowners can expect a range of $25,000 to $50,000+, depending on material choices and scope. While labor costs in rural Ness County can be slightly lower than in major metros, material costs are largely consistent, and the remote location can sometimes add modest transportation fees for specialized contractors or materials. It's crucial to get detailed, written estimates from local contractors that account for the specific layout and challenges of your home.
Kansas experiences significant temperature swings and humidity changes, which can cause wood to expand and contract. We recommend choosing stable materials like quartz countertops and engineered hardwood or luxury vinyl plank flooring that withstand these fluctuations. For timing, scheduling interior work during the late fall, winter, or early spring is often ideal, as contractors are less occupied with exterior projects, and you avoid the peak humidity of summer which can affect paint and adhesive curing.
Yes, you must check with the City of Bazine Clerk's office and Ness County Building Department. Typically, structural changes, electrical work, and plumbing alterations require permits and inspections to ensure they meet Kansas state building codes. This is especially important for safety and can impact your home insurance. A reputable local contractor will usually handle this process, but as the homeowner, it's your responsibility to verify permits are pulled.

In older Bazine homes, it's common to discover outdated wiring (like knob-and-tube), plumbing that may not be to current code, or structural surprises behind walls. Additionally, because many local homes rely on well water and septic systems, a remodel that adds a dishwasher or pot filler may require assessing your septic capacity. A thorough contractor will budget a contingency of 10-20% for such unforeseen issues once walls are opened.
